Are you doing this via the command line? If so then you need to substitute : for .
I ran into this issue when I first setup my toaster as well. I was doing /home/vpopmail/bin/vadduser [EMAIL PROTECTED] and it was failing. If you do /home/vpopmail/bin/vadduser firstname:[EMAIL PROTECTED] it qmail picks this up as a .
